Output 8c08a374e591be9392262959d3f6fe6c089268cf5ac5e171b046f27fbd668285:15

value
19950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d478ce82becf37122462ea2143d4592d7ccd6a OP_EQUAL
address
39c8Zr7or9U3NGvscWoiRwcWeRGRbK4JLx
transaction
8c08a374e591be9392262959d3f6fe6c089268cf5ac5e171b046f27fbd668285
spent
true